QUEBEC JUDICIAL APPOINTMENT ANNOUNCED

OTTAWA, December 15, 2006 -- The Honourable Vic Toews, Q.C., Minister of Justice and Attorney General of Canada, today announced the following appointment:

The Honourable Robert Dufresne, a lawyer with the firm of Cain Lamarre Casgrain Wells in Val-d'Or is appointed a Puisne Judge of the Superior Court of Quebec, Districts of Abitibi, Rouyn-Noranda and Témiscamingue. He replaces Mr. Justice I. St-Julien (Val-d'Or) who elected to become a supernumerary judge.

Mr. Justice Robert Dufresne received a Bachelor of Laws in 1987 from the Université de Montréal and a D.E.C. in 1984 from Rosemont College and was admitted to the Bar of Quebec in 1988. He has practised since 1988 with Cain Lamarre Casgrain Wells and its predecessor firms in Val-d'Or. Mr. Justice Dufresne's practice expertise is in the areas of civil law, municipal law, insurance law, banking law, insolvency and bankruptcy law and litigation. He has been a member of the Executive Committee on Illegal Practice, Barreau du Québec and has held various positions with the Barreau de l'Abitibi-Témiscamingue. He is a Past President of the Kinsmen Club of Val-d'Or.

This appointment is effective December 23, 2006.
